Inspection on 5/14/2025
High Priority
5
Intermediate
0
Basic
2
Total
7
Disposition: Follow-up Inspection Required
Inspection Details:
- 25-06-4:Basic - Coffee filters not stored inverted or protected from contamination near the iced tea machine. The operator properly stored the filters. Corrected On-Site
- 33-38-4:Basic - No waste receptacle installed at handwash sink provided with disposable towels near the ice machine. The operator provided the hand sink with a trash can. Corrected On-Site
- 01B-02-5:High Priority - Stop Sale issued on time/temperature control for safety food due to temperature abuse. Observed cut lettuce (49F - Cold Holding); cut tomatoes (54F - Cold Holding); sliced cheese (50F - Cold Holding) in the center reach in cooler on the make line. Temperature log states 37F at 4AM. 62F ambient temperature at time of inspection. The operator stated the items had been held for approximately 4.5 hours. The operator discarded the potentially hazardous foods. Corrected On-Site
- 03A-02-5:High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. Observed cut lettuce (49F - Cold Holding); cut tomatoes (54F - Cold Holding); sliced cheese (50F - Cold Holding) in the center reach in cooler on the make line. Temperature log states 37F at 4AM. 62F ambient temperature at time of inspection. The operator stated the items had been held for approximately 4.5 hours. The operator discarded the potentially hazardous foods. Corrected On-Site Warning
- 41-10-4:High Priority -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Observed a spray bottle of bathroom cleaner stored on a shelf with paper to go bags. The operator properly store the spray chemical. Corrected On-Site
- 29-42-4:High Priority - Vacuum breaker missing at mop sink faucet with splitter added to mop sink faucet.
- 41-18-4:High Priority - Warewashing sanitizing solution exceeding the maximum concentration allowed. Observed the quaternary sanitizer solution at the three compartment sink at 500ppm. The operator diluted the solution to 200ppm. Corrected On-Site
Food safety inspection conducted on 5/14/2025 revealed 7 total violations (5 high priority, 0 intermediate, 2 basic).
Inspection on 9/30/2024
High Priority
0
Intermediate
0
Basic
3
Total
3
Disposition: Met Inspection Standards
Inspection Details:
- 16-21-4:Basic - Accumulation of debris on the top exterior of warewashing machine.
- 13-03-4:Basic - Employee with no hair restraint while engaging in food preparation.
- 42-01-4:Basic - Wet mop not stored in a manner to allow the mop to dry in the mop sink. The operator properly stored the wet mop. Corrected On-Site
Food safety inspection conducted on 9/30/2024 revealed 3 total violations (0 high priority, 0 intermediate, 3 basic).
Inspection on 9/28/2023
High Priority
2
Intermediate
1
Basic
1
Total
4
Disposition: Met Inspection Standards
Inspection Details:
- 13-07-4:Basic - Employee wearing jewelry other than a plain ring on their hands/arms while preparing food. Observed multiple employees engaged in food preparation wearing a watch, bracelet, and rings other than a plain band. The employees removed the jewelry. Corrected On-Site
- 14-31-5:High Priority - Nonfood-grade bags used in direct contact with food. Observed raw frozen steak stored in a to go bag in the reach in freezer at the end of the cook line. The operator properly stored the raw steak. Corrected On-Site
- 08A-05-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Observed raw shell eggs stored over cut lettuce in the reach in cooler near the drive-thru. The operator properly stored the raw shell eggs. Observed raw frozen steak removed from it's original packaging stored over McGriddle buns in the reach in freezer on the cook line. Corrected On-Site
- 31B-05-4:Intermediate - Paper towel dispenser at handwash sink not working/unable to dispense paper towels on the cook line. The operator fixed the paper towel dispenser. Corrected On-Site
Food safety inspection conducted on 9/28/2023 revealed 4 total violations (2 high priority, 1 intermediate, 1 basic).
